7 fascinating creatures that have stunning chocolate brown colour

Chocolate brown is a deep and solid colour, which most creatures of the world have. This dark colour not only makes them beautiful but also in most cases, acts as a camouflage in their natural habitats. From playful mammals to majestic birds, these animals showcase the diverse ways brown can manifest in the animal kingdom.

Chocolate Labrador Retriever

The Chocolate Labrador Retriever is a beloved breed known for its friendly and outgoing nature. Their deep brown coat gives them a distinctive look, making them stand out among other Labradors. These dogs are not only visually striking but also excel in various roles, including service work and search-and-rescue missions.

Capybara

Capybaras are the largest rodents in the world, native to South America. Their chocolate-brown fur helps them blend into the wetlands and forests they inhabit. Known for their calm demeanor, capybaras are social animals that often live in groups and are frequently seen lounging near water sources.

Brown Hyena

Unlike their striped cousins, brown hyenas have a thick, shaggy chocolate-brown coat. Native to southern Africa, they are primarily scavengers, feeding on carcasses left by other predators. Their unique appearance and solitary nature make them a fascinating subject of study in the animal kingdom.

European Mink

The European mink is a small, elusive carnivore with a rich brown coat. Once widespread across Europe, their numbers have dwindled due to habitat loss and competition with other species. Efforts are underway to conserve this rare and beautiful animal.

Brown Woolly Monkey

The brown woolly monkey is a monkey, discovered in the rainforests of the South America, and has a thick coat of chocolate-brown fur which keeps them warm in their wet climate. These are tree dwelling primates, who spend a majority of their time on trees and are characterised by their social affections among groups.

Sable Antelope

Sable antelope is an impressive herbivore, which is indigenous to southern Africa. Male ones are dark brown or black in colour and have spectacular curved horns. They are also referred to as powerful and agile and they are usually regarded as an icon of grace and power in the wild.

Brown Fish Owl

Brown fish owl is a nocturnal bird of prey that is located in some regions of Asia. Its plumage of chocolate-brown and its large and expressive eyes render it an excellent predator of fish and amphibians. These owls do well in moving through thick forests and wetlands in their hunting activities at night.
